    • Credo Reference Use Credo Reference to find: Encyclopedias, Dictionaries, Biographies, Quotations, Bilingual Dictionaries, Measurement Conversions, and more! Credo is a full-text, searchable, and easy-to-use database of over 400 Reference works in over 20 subject areas. It contains overview information, much like the popular website Wikipedia, but the sources in Credo are reliable and can be cited in any research assignment.
